Enable URL-keyed anonymized data collection in Google Chrome and prevents users from changing this setting.
URL-keyed anonymized data collection sends URLs of pages the user visits to Google to make searches and browsing better.
If you enable this policy, URL-keyed anonymized data collection is always active.
If you disable this policy, URL-keyed anonymized data collection is never active.
If this policy is left not set, URL-keyed anonymized data collection will be enabled but the user will be able to change it.
Registry Hive | HKEY_CURRENT_USER |
Registry Path | Software\Policies\Google\ChromeOS |
Value Name | UrlKeyedAnonymizedDataCollectionEnabled |
Value Type | REG_DWORD |
Enabled Value | 1 |
Disabled Value | 0 |
